Details
cgiChkMasterPwd.exe before 8.0.0.142 in Trend Micro OfficeScan Corporate Edition 8.0 allows remote attackers to bypass the password requirement and gain access to the Management Console via an empty hash and empty encrypted password string, related to "stored decrypted user logon information."
